Title: Jin Seok Im: Innovator in 3D Imaging and AI Object Identification
Introduction
Jin Seok Im is a prominent inventor based in Seoul, South Korea, known for his significant contributions to the fields of 3D imaging and artificial intelligence. With a total of 18 patents to his name, he has made remarkable advancements that enhance user experience in various technologies.
Latest Patents
Among his latest innovations is an "Apparatus and method for providing 3-dimensional around view through a user interface module included in a vehicle." This invention utilizes multiple image pickup units to create a comprehensive 3D view, integrating advanced features such as depth estimation and AI modules. Another notable patent is the "Apparatus and method for identifying object," which employs a small-sized learning model to efficiently identify objects in images. This technology modifies received images and utilizes a neural network to determine object types, showcasing the potential of AI in image processing.
